Why Should You Bury Garlic in a Rice Container? Special Benefits Every Household Needs
Rice is an essential staple in daily life. Most families buy a certain amount of rice to store and use over time, reducing the need for frequent shopping trips.
When storing rice for daily use, you should bury a few cloves of garlic in the rice container. This simple action can help solve a common household problem.
Why Should You Bury Garlic in a Rice Container?
Garlic is a must-have ingredient in every kitchen. Aside from enhancing the flavor of dishes, it also has various other benefits.
Burying garlic in a rice container helps prevent weevils from infesting the rice.
By placing a few dry garlic cloves in the container, weevils will no longer dare to invade. The strong, pungent smell of garlic repels these pests, preventing them from attacking and multiplying in the rice. This simple method helps maintain the freshness and quality of the rice, ensuring food safety.
Although rice infested by weevils can still be cooked, its taste and nutritional value will be diminished. Therefore, proper rice storage is crucial to avoid pest infestations.
Other Rice Storage Methods
- Clean the storage container regularly
After prolonged use, the rice container should be thoroughly cleaned. It must be completely dry before adding new rice to prevent moisture buildup.
Store the rice container in a dry, well-ventilated area with a tightly sealed lid. Humid conditions can lead to mold growth, which is harmful to health.
- Store rice with black pepper
Black pepper is another effective solution for preventing rice weevils. Place black pepper in a small mesh bag to keep it separate from the rice, then place the bag inside the container. The strong, spicy aroma of black pepper will deter pests from entering. Additionally, the fragrance of black pepper can enhance the aroma of cooked rice. Replace the bag with fresh pepper when the scent fades.
- Store rice with dried chili peppers
Similar to garlic and black pepper, dried chili peppers can also help repel weevils. Simply bury a few dried chilies in the rice container. The strong, spicy scent of chilies will drive the pests away.
To prevent dried chilies from breaking apart and their seeds mixing with the rice, it is best to remove the seeds before placing them in the container.
- Store rice in the refrigerator
If the amount of rice being stored is not too large, you can place it in an airtight container or a sealed plastic bag and store it in the refrigerator. The low temperature prevents weevils from reproducing and infesting the rice.
By using these simple yet effective storage methods, you can keep your rice fresh, pest-free, and safe for consumption.
